#dff63a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dff63a is composed of 87.5% red, 96.5%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 59.6%. #dff63a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ff74 with #bfed00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#dff63a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080900 is the darkest color, while #fdfff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dff63a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9f91 is the less saturated color, while #e5fe32 is the most saturated one.
